Crude Oil: Global Dynamics
Crude oil remains the most watched commodity. Brent and WTI crude oil prices continue to fluctuate due to geopolitical tensions and shifts in OPEC policy. Currently, demand from developing countries such as India and China is increasing. However, fears of a global economic recession could put downward pressure on prices. Investors need to monitor weekly oil stock reports as well as decisions from the OPEC meeting.
Gold: Safe Haven amidst Uncertainty
Gold is known as a “safe haven” in times of market uncertainty. In 2023, investors will pay attention to the interest rate policy taken by the US Federal Reserve. Rising interest rates tend to depress gold prices, but inflation uncertainty could lift demand. The latest news indicates a surge in buying interest from central banks in various countries, which has the potential to support gold prices.
Agriculture: Climate Change Affects Crop Yields
The agricultural sector faces serious challenges with climate change. Prices of key commodities such as coffee, sugar and wheat fluctuate from year to year. Drought in several major producing countries is affecting supply. For example, there are reports that Russian wheat production is expected to fall due to bad weather. Monitoring weather reports and agricultural-related adjustment strategies are key to understanding price movements.
Base Metals: Aluminum and Copper in the Midst of the Energy Transition
As the global transition towards renewable energy continues, base metals such as aluminum and copper are increasingly in demand. Copper, which is crucial for electrical technology and electric vehicles, is expected to see an increase in demand as various infrastructure projects are launched. However, investors should remain alert to the risk of trade tensions between major countries.
Coffee: Fluctuations Driven by Demand and Weather
The coffee market continues to fluctuate, with Brazil as a major producer often affected by weather conditions. Climate change causes inefficiencies in production, impacting prices on the global market. Most recently, there have been reports showing a surge in demand from European and US markets for specialty coffee, potentially supporting coffee prices.
